Buying Guide for 7 Gallon Chicken Waterer
Why I Choose a 7 Gallon Capacity
When I first started raising chickens, I quickly realized the importance of having a reliable water source. A 7 gallon chicken waterer strikes a great balance for me—it holds enough water to keep my flock hydrated for several days without constant refilling, especially during hot weather. This size is ideal for small to medium-sized flocks, reducing my daily maintenance time.
Material Matters to Me
I pay close attention to the material of the waterer. Plastic waterers are lightweight and easy to clean, but I make sure the plastic is food-grade and durable to avoid cracks. Metal waterers are sturdier and less likely to be chewed on by my chickens, but they can be heavier and prone to rust if not properly coated. Choosing a material that fits my maintenance routine and climate conditions is key.
Design and Ease of Cleaning
A waterer with a simple design makes my life easier. I look for wide openings that allow me to fill and clean it without hassle. Removable parts are a big plus because they help me thoroughly wash the waterer and prevent algae buildup or bacteria growth. I avoid complicated designs that trap dirt or make refilling a chore.
Stability and Spill Prevention
I consider how stable the waterer is once filled. A 7 gallon waterer can be heavy, so I prefer one with a broad base or a design that prevents tipping. My chickens can be quite lively, so minimizing spills and messes keeps their area drier and healthier. Some waterers come with features like non-slip bottoms or weighted bases, which I find very helpful.
Portability and Placement
Since I sometimes need to move the waterer around my coop or run, I think about portability. Handles or grips make carrying a full 7 gallon waterer easier for me. Also, I consider where I’ll place it—whether inside the coop, in the run, or a shaded area—and choose a waterer that fits well in that space without being cumbersome.
Weather Resistance and Durability
Because my waterer is exposed to the elements, I look for models designed to withstand sun, rain, and temperature fluctuations. UV-resistant plastic helps prevent cracking and fading, and metal options should be rust-resistant. Durable construction means I don’t have to replace the waterer frequently, saving me money in the long run.
